FAQ

1. What is the main function of the Schneider VW3M8A11R05GJ encoder cable?
The VW3M8A11R05GJ is a dedicated encoder feedback cable used to connect a compatible servo motor encoder with the corresponding servo drive or motion-control equipment. The encoder provides feedback information that allows the control system to monitor motor position, speed, and direction during operation. Reliable feedback transmission is essential for accurate servo positioning and stable speed regulation. Using a dedicated encoder cable helps maintain a reliable signal path and reduces the possibility of feedback errors caused by incorrect wiring, poor connections, or unsuitable cable construction.

2. What type of feedback information is transmitted through the VW3M8A11R05GJ?
The VW3M8A11R05GJ is intended to transmit encoder feedback signals between a compatible servo motor and its control system. Depending on the specific encoder and servo architecture, these signals can provide information about motor position, rotational speed, direction, and movement status. The servo drive uses this information to compare the commanded motor movement with actual motor behavior and continuously adjust operation. If the feedback signal is interrupted or corrupted, the drive may detect an encoder fault or the motor may fail to achieve the required positioning accuracy.

3. Why is shielding important for the VW3M8A11R05GJ encoder cable?
Encoder feedback signals can be sensitive to electromagnetic interference generated by servo drives, motor power circuits, switching devices, and other industrial equipment. The shielded construction of the VW3M8A11R05GJ helps reduce the influence of electrical noise on the feedback signal. Correct shielding can improve signal stability and reduce the likelihood of false encoder alarms, position errors, or unstable servo operation. During installation, the shielding should be handled according to the requirements of the compatible servo system, and the feedback cable should preferably be routed away from high-power motor wiring.

4. How should the VW3M8A11R05GJ be installed in a servo system?
Before installation, the servo drive, motor, and associated equipment should be switched off and electrically isolated according to the applicable safety procedures. Connect the cable to the designated encoder interfaces and make sure the connectors are correctly aligned and securely locked. The cable should be routed without excessive pulling, twisting, crushing, or sharp bending. It should also be protected from sharp mechanical edges and unnecessary sources of vibration. Where possible, keep the encoder cable separated from servo motor power cables and other high-current wiring to minimize electromagnetic interference. After installation, inspect all connections before energizing the system.

5. What should be checked if an encoder or feedback alarm occurs?
Start by checking both ends of the VW3M8A11R05GJ to make sure the connectors are completely inserted and securely fixed. Inspect the cable for cuts, abrasion, crushing, excessive bending, or other physical damage. The connector contacts should also be checked for contamination, corrosion, deformation, or poor contact. After the physical inspection, review the servo drive’s alarm information and diagnostic records to determine the type of feedback fault. If the cable and connections appear normal, qualified maintenance personnel can perform appropriate continuity, insulation, or signal tests with suitable equipment to determine whether the problem is related to the cable, encoder, drive, or another part of the servo system.

6. What problems can result from incorrect installation of the encoder cable?
Incorrect installation can cause encoder communication errors, loss of position feedback, unstable speed regulation, positioning deviations, servo enable failures, or unexpected motor shutdowns. A connector that is not fully secured may work intermittently and fail when the machine vibrates or moves. Improper cable routing can also expose the feedback circuit to excessive electromagnetic interference from motor power cables or switching equipment. In precision motion-control applications, even short interruptions or disturbances in feedback information can affect machine positioning accuracy. Correct connector installation, shielding, routing, and mechanical protection are therefore important for reliable operation.

7. Can the VW3M8A11R05GJ be replaced with a standard encoder cable?
A standard encoder cable should not be used as a direct replacement unless its electrical and mechanical characteristics have been verified for the specific servo application. Encoder cables can differ in conductor configuration, shielding construction, signal characteristics, connector pin assignment, and compatibility with particular servo motors and drives. Two cables may have similar external connectors while having completely different internal wiring. When replacing the VW3M8A11R05GJ, the replacement should be checked against the original system requirements, including encoder type, connector configuration, signal arrangement, shielding method, and compatibility with the connected Schneider Electric equipment.

8. What precautions should be taken when routing the VW3M8A11R05GJ?
The encoder cable should be routed to minimize both electromagnetic interference and mechanical stress. Whenever practical, keep it separated from servo motor power cables, inverter output wiring, contactor circuits, and other high-current or high-frequency wiring. Avoid sharp bends, excessive pulling, crushing, abrasion, and contact with moving mechanical components unless the installation has been specifically designed for continuous movement. The cable should also be secured appropriately so that vibration does not place excessive stress on the connectors. After installation, inspect the complete cable route and verify the connector condition before commissioning to help ensure stable encoder feedback and reliable servo operation.
